My name is Susan Miller, and I work from home, creating handpainted  Christmas ornaments
and illustrating children's books.

I started hand painting Christmas bulbs over 25 years ago... When I was looking for
a way to remember the year I'd spent with my family.



I walked into a store in West Hartford, Connecticut -- tracking snow behind me --
And while I was browsing, I fell in love with this folksy hand painted  ornament from Ecuador.


Inspired by that Christmas bulb, I started hand painting my own ornaments  and giving them to
my co-workers around the holiday season.

And they absolutely fell in love with them!

I called them Jingle Bulbs, because of the jingly "bell" on the top of each one.

Each bulb is limited edition,  an original hand painted design, signed and dated by me, the artist.



I have great pride and pay meticulous attention to detail crafting each one of these keepsakes,
and my passion for the decorative arts and my love for painted surfaces heavily influences
each Jingle Bulb that goes out.
